Polish developer 11 Bit Studios has unveiled a new trailer for their eagerly awaited sci-fi adventure, The Alters, which is inching closer to its release date. In this latest reveal, the studio took a moment to reminisce about one of their most celebrated titles: the wartime survival game This War of Mine, which catapulted them to international acclaim over a decade ago.
While This War of Mine is renowned for its somber and despairing ambiance, The Alters introduces a more vibrant and frequently humorous storyline, focusing on the trials faced by alternate versions of the protagonist, Jan Dolski. Despite the stark contrast in tone, the developers highlight a deep-seated connection between the two games.
Although the settings and atmospheres of the games differ significantly, both are anchored in the theme of survival. In This War of Mine, players are thrust into the grim realities of war within a besieged city, managing resources and facing daily challenges to keep their group alive. Conversely, The Alters frames survival as a frantic race against time, where players must continuously relocate their mobile base to escape the destructive path of an unforgiving sun that turns everything to dust.
Both titles challenge players to step beyond their comfort zones, venturing into hostile territories in search of scarce resources. The primary distinction lies in the protagonists: This War of Mine has players guiding a group of ordinary civilians, whereas The Alters introduces a unique team made up of alternate versions of the main character, Jan Dolski.
The Alters is slated for release in 2025 on PC, PlayStation 5, and Xbox Series X|S. Excitingly, the game will be available on Xbox Game Pass and PC Game Pass from launch day, ensuring a wide audience can experience this innovative take on survival and alternate realities.
